Two students were killed on Sunday in Vijayawada after their speeding sports bike, travelling at 170 kmph, crashed.  

The victims were identified as Hritik Sashi Chaudary and Yeshwant, aged 19 and 21 respectively.

The incident took place in the early hours near Jammichettu centre in Moghalrajapuram, Vijayawada, reported The Times of India.

The vehicle, KTM Duke 390 cc which clocked 170 kmph, hit a median, after losing control. 

The bike then hit an electric police and the impact of the collision flung the bike 150 metres away, and its wreckage was found all over the place of the incident, reported TOI.

While Hritik was a resident of Haryana pursuing BBA, Yeshwant, a resident of Hyderabad was pursuing B.Tech in Vijayawada.

The duo borrowed the bike from their friend, Aman and went on a drive.

CCTV cameras have captured the horrifying incident, and the speedometer was stuck at 170 kmph, at the time of the crash.

The Machavaram police have filed a case and shifted the bodies to the government hospital for post-mortem.

TOI reported that Yeshwant’s eyes were donated by his family.
